The Federal Way Chamber Ensemble, led by concertmaster Marjorie Kransberg-Talvi, plays selections that will transport the audience to the City of Light. Featuring pianist William Chapman Nyaho and cellist Mara Finkelstein, the program includes cherished works by Ravel, Debussy, Gershwin, Saint-Saëns, and Piazzolla.
